Bitcoin Block 673896

Bitcoin Block 673,896 was mined on and contains 2,984 transactions. Miners collected 1.23822438 BTC in transaction fees with a block reward of 7.48822438 BTC. Block size: 1.44 MB.

Block Details

Hash00000000000000000002b26d034979c0c1697ff52a93a133f884b34c3cdde2cb
Timestamp
Transactions2,984
AddressesView addresses
Size1.44 MB
Weight3,993,569 WU
Total fees1.23822438 BTC
Avg fee rate124.0 sat/vB
Block reward7.48822438 BTC
Inputs / Outputs5,187 / 12,081
SegWit txs2,156 (72.3%)
RBF signaling555 (18.6%)
Difficulty2.14e+13
Merkle root36de97835a4ab8f98c4456a2140230ab3f2d6d1b899798305633cd39f05f9cf3
Nonce3,253,129,279
Version0x20800000
Previous block00000000000000000002a2a8d979ce759db76dbba54a7a473db4dd8af26b0954
Next blockBlock 673897 →

Block Visualization

Block Statistics

See how this block compares to network trends: